PORTLAND, Ore. (KOIN) — When a man who drove an explosives-filled vehicle into one of Portland’s most storied athletic clubs this weekend, one thing was immediately clear: there had been signs.
Court filings obtained by KOIN 6 News show that the man, 49-year-old Bruce Valentine Whitman, had long struggled with mental health and had received inpatient treatment as recently as February.
Whitman drove a vehicle full of explosives into the Multnomah Athletic Club early Saturday morning, killing himself and setting fire to the building. Whitman previously worked as a bartender at the club, known as the MAC.
